Introduction

A fire-resistant finishing agent is a chemical application used on textiles, fabrics, and various materials to decrease their flammability and prevent the spread of fire. These agents function by chemically modifying the structure of the material to enhance its resistance to ignition or by creating a protective layer that delays combustion. Fire-resistant finishing agents are frequently utilised in sectors like construction, transportation, and personal protective gear, along with home furnishings and upholstery, to comply with safety regulations. Phosphorous flame retardants lead this market because of their environmental safety and effectiveness, whereas halogen flame retardants are decreasing due to ecological issues. The construction and textile industries, particularly for furniture covers, drapes, and safety apparel, are significant application fields. Furthermore, advancements in eco-friendly and non-harmful fire-retardant technologies are affecting market trends.

1. Textile Sector Innovation

Increase in demand for long-lasting, non-halogenated fire-resistant coatings for protective apparel, furniture, and drapes. Concentrate on durable formulas that withstand washing for extended effectiveness.

 

2. Construction Material Integration

Increase in fire-resistant coatings for timber, insulation, and composites utilised in sustainable buildings and modular construction. Focus on agents that are low in VOCs and free from formaldehyde.

 

3. Aerospace & Automotive Adoption

Efficient, low-weight flame retardants for interior panels, wiring insulation, and upholstery fabrics. Adherence to FAA and ISO flammability regulations is fostering innovation.

 

4. Bio-Based and Eco-Friendly Formulations

Increase in phosphorus and nitrogen-based compounds sourced from renewable materials. Regulatory demands are accelerating the shift towards halogen-free options.

 

5. Multifunctional Finishing Agents

Agents now provide a blend of flame resistance, antimicrobial properties, and water repellent features. Widely used in medical fabrics and military equipment.

1. Avocet

Headquarters: Pune, Maharashtra, India

The product name CETAFLAM and its flame retardants are compatible with multiple fibres such as polyester, cotton, wool, polyamide, and blends, and can be utilised through dyeing, padding, back coating, or as additives. Avocet's offerings emphasise dependable flame-retardant capabilities while minimising environmental impact and lowering energy consumption, promoting the creation of sustainable fabrics. A number of their flame retardants are free from halogens and antimony, as well as Oeko-Tex certified, adhering to strict safety and environmental criteria, making them appropriate for use in home textiles, automotive fabrics, protective garments, and public transport industries.

 

2. Zschimmer and Schwarz

Headquarters: Lahnstein, Rhineland-Palatinate

Their flame retardants are formulated for different fabric types, including cellulose, synthetic materials, and blends, offering long-lasting flame resistance while preserving the quality and softness of the fabric. The company’s fireproofing products are included in their broader range of textile treatment chemicals, which also features softeners, defoamers, and repellents. Zschimmer & Schwarz focuses on eco-friendly, halogen-free flame-retardant chemicals, in line with present regulatory movements and sustainability objectives. In addition to textiles, the firm also offers fire safety solutions for coatings and fire-resistant glass.

 

3. Rudolph GmbH

Headquarters: Geretsried, Germany

Their product line under the RUCO-FLAM name features several flame retardants that are free from pigments, halogens, and antimony, aimed at lowering flammability while preserving the softness and feel of textiles. Rudolf’s flame retardants are appropriate for cellulose-based, synthetic, and blended fibres, ensuring long-lasting flame resistance for uses including workwear, children’s sleepwear, upholstery, and decorative fabrics. Rudolf also provides sophisticated fire protection coatings such as HENSOTHERM aimed at structural fire safety for wood, steel, and concrete, emphasising eco-friendly, water-based, and VOC-free formulations that meet strict European and global fire safety regulations.

 

4. Buckman

Headquarters: Memphis, Tennessee, United States

Buckman is a specialised chemical firm providing a variety of cutting-edge fire-retardant finishing agents through the Bulab Flamebloc and Flamebloc product lines. Their flame retardants comprise boron-derived substances like barium metaborate and calcium metaborate, which serve as efficient fire retardants and smoke suppressants in plastics, textiles, paints, rubber, and coatings. These items function by creating a shielding char layer when burned, minimising flame spread and hazardous gases. Buckman flame retardants are utilised alongside halogen donors to improve fire resistance and can serve as a substitute for conventional antimony-based retardants, minimising smoke and toxicity.

 

5. THOR

Headquarters: Wincham, Margate, United Kingdom

THOR is recognised for its Aflammit line of flame retardants, which improve fire resistance by creating protective char layers and preventing combustion. The firm focuses on eco-friendly flame retardants derived from phosphorus and nitrogen chemistry as substitutes for halogen and antimony-based materials. THOR partners with key players such as BASF to create sustainable, high-performing flame retardant additives, providing technical assistance and laboratory testing to address changing global market demands. The corporation operates internationally with production and technical sites located in Germany, Mexico, China, and the UK.
